subject: NComm 28800 to 57600

Hi Kim,
 
 KF>> I have a NetComm InModem 28800 (V.Fast), and wan't to run it at
 KF>> 57600Bps. What do I have to do to my Init's?  And my BNU line?
 
 AM> 57600 is the speed that the port is running at- you cannot get your
 AM> modem to run at 57600, it's 28800 and that's as fast as it'll go
 AM> unless you upgrade to 33600.

 KF> How come a fellow sysop of mine runs his 9600 at 14400 and 
 KF> also runs his 14400 on his second node at 28800.

 KF> Hmmm????

This is wrong. The speeds 19200, 38400, 57600, 115200 and the like are all
port speeds. The modem cannot run higher than it's set to, well some US
Robotics modems can. If you can tell me how to do it, I'll try it, and if it
works, then I'll believe it. Otherwise it sounds like bull to me.
